No one was injured in a fire this morning at an auto service shop in Harmar.
An emergency dispatch supervisor said a blaze was reported at 10:07 a.m. at Hazlett's Auto Service on Russellton Road.
The supervisor said flames had broken through the roof of the building, which is believed to house at least one upstairs apartment.
No other information was immediately available.
